Hon. Niyi Lukman Adekunle, an Action Congress of Nigeria, ACN, chairmanship aspirant for Agege Local Government Area, Lagos, Southwest Nigeria, has promised a total transformation of the area if he is elected as the chairman of the area in the forthcoming local government election.

Adekunle made the statement at his campaign office in Agege, Lagos at an event organised for the public declaration of his intention to vie for the number one seat in the local government.

He explained that if given the opportunity, he will do everything possible to take the council to an enviable height especially in the area of education and improvement in the standard of living of the residents.

He maintained that his educational background and experience as a grassroots person coupled with his upbringing in the neighbourhood of Agege has placed him at vantage position to know the needs of his people and how best to satisfy those needs.

According to him, “the present administration in the state under the able and indefatigable leadership of Governor Babatunde Raji Fashola, has done his best in projecting the image of the state even outside the country and I promise to follow suit by doing all that would make Agege Local Government to be the envy of all as far as local governance is concerned. Kudos should also be given to the national leader of ACN, Asiwaju Bola Ahmed Tinubu, for his leadership role in the state,“ Adekunle said.

He added that the council under his administration will ensure harmonious relationship with youths, CDC/CDA, relevant business groups and community heads, a step which will let us know the needs of the residents and at the same time guide us on how immediate solution could be found to them.

Adekunle, therefore, called for the cooperation and support of all the residents to ensure his ambition is realised by voting him as the next chairman of the area.
